mirror of
https://github.com/Ponce/slackbuilds
synced 2024-11-14 21:56:41 +01:00
6c0140c480
Signed-off-by: Willy Sudiarto Raharjo <willysr@slackbuilds.org>
12 lines
689 B
Text
12 lines
689 B
Text
Efficient arrays of booleans -- C extension.
|
|
|
|
This module provides an object type which efficiently represents an
|
|
array of booleans. Bitarrays are sequence types and behave very much
|
|
like usual lists. Eight bits are represented by one byte in a
|
|
contiguous block of memory. The user can select between two
|
|
representations; little-endian and big-endian. All of the
|
|
functionality is implemented in C. Methods for accessing the machine
|
|
representation are provided. This can be useful when bit level access
|
|
to binary files is required, such as portable bitmap image files
|
|
(.pbm). Also, when dealing with compressed data which uses variable
|
|
bit length encoding, you may find this module useful.
|